Recall Notification Report 005-2006
|
|
|
|
Product(s) Recalled:
Chicken Egg Rolls
Production Dates/Identifying Codes:
Produced December 8, 2005. The following products are subject to recall:
- 36-ounce packages of "China Express, Chicken Egg Rolls, With Sweet & Sour Sauce Packets, 12 Count." Each package bears the establishment number "P-13218" inside the USDA mark of inspection. The packages also bear the case code "2003425" or "1003425."
Problem/Reason for Recall:
The packages state that the egg rolls are filled with chicken, but they may instead contain shrimp, a known allergen.
How/When Discovered:
The establishment received two consumer complaints, reported the incidents to FSIS and the recall information was received on February 16, 2006.

Quantity Recalled:
Approximately 6,426 pounds
Quantity Recovered:
The firm reports recovery of 691 pounds of product.
Distribution:
Nationwide
Recall Classification:
Class I
Recall Notification Level:
Retail
